History of Nike Air Max

The Nike Air Max line revolutionized the sneaker industry with its introduction of visible Air cushioning technology. This innovation made its debut in 1987 with the Air Max 1, designed by the legendary Tinker Hatfield. The design showcased the Air cushioning, which was previously hidden, allowing consumers to appreciate the technology that enhances comfort and performance. This sneaker not only marked a technological breakthrough but also became a cultural icon, leading to various iterations and collaborations over the years.

Key Features of Air Max Shoes

Innovative Cushioning Technology

At the heart of every Air Max sneaker is its unique cushioning system. The visible Air unit provides not only comfort but also support during various activities. This technology has evolved across different models, leading to larger and more efficient Air units, such as the 720-degree cushioning in the Air Max 720.

Popularity and Cultural Impact

The Air Max line has significantly influenced sneaker culture since its inception. The first commercial for the Air Max 1 in 1987 marked a turning point in how sneakers were marketed. Over the years, the shoes have appeared in music videos, films, and on the feet of celebrities, solidifying their status as a cultural staple. Limited edition releases and collaborations have further fueled demand, making certain models highly sought-after by collectors.

Maintenance and Care

To ensure longevity and maintain the appearance of your Air Max sneakers, proper care is essential. Here are some t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a soft brush or cloth to remove dirt and grime. For deeper cleaning, a mix of mild soap and water can be used.
  • Proper Storage: Store your sneakers in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Consider using shoe trees to maintain their shape.
  • Avoid Excessive Wear: While Air Max shoes are designed for various activities, avoid using them for extreme sports or in harsh conditions to prevent damage.
